oh-my-githubcopilot (OMG) brings the multi-agent orchestration paradigm — pioneered by oh-my-claudecode (OMC) for Claude Code — to GitHub Copilot, now further supercharged with the best features of Everything Claude Code (ECC).
Where OMC supercharges Claude Code with specialized agents and workflow automation, OMG does the same for Copilot's agent mode in VS Code. And with the ECC integration (v1.1.0) plus the adapted OMC skill port, OMG now includes language-specialist reviewers, TDD enforcement, rapid security scanning, durable ultragoal checkpoints, research helpers, release guidance, visual QA, and more. Instead of a single assistant doing everything, OMG coordinates 28 specialized agents and 37 reusable skills through an MCP server, giving you structured workflows for planning, execution, review, and verification — all within your existing Copilot setup.
This is not a fork or copy of OMC or ECC. It is an independent implementation built from scratch to leverage GitHub Copilot's agent customization features (
.agent.md,.prompt.md,SKILL.md, MCP tools), drawing architectural inspiration from OMC's multi-agent approach and selectively integrating ECC's proven patterns.

OMG includes a TypeScript MCP (Model Context Protocol) server that provides persistent state management for workflows. Registered via .vscode/mcp.json, it exposes tools for:
| Tool Group | Tools | Purpose |
|---|---|---|
| State | omg_read_state, omg_write_state, omg_clear_state, omg_list_active |
Workflow state CRUD and active mode listing |
| PRD | omg_create_prd, omg_read_prd, omg_update_story, omg_verify_story |
PRD creation, story tracking, and verification |
| Workflow | omg_check_completion, omg_next_phase, omg_get_phase_info |
Phase transitions, completion checks, phase inspection |
| Memory | omg_read_memory, omg_write_memory, omg_delete_memory |
Project-scoped knowledge persistence |
| Model Router | omg_select_model |
Model recommendation based on task complexity |
| Ultragoal | omg_ultragoal_create, omg_ultragoal_status, omg_ultragoal_checkpoint, omg_ultragoal_complete |
Durable goal tracking with fail-closed checkpoint evidence |
State is stored under .omg/ in the workspace:
.omg/
├── state/ # Workflow state files per mode
├── ultragoal/ # Durable ultragoal ledger and checkpoints
├── plans/ # Work plans for execution
├── prd.json # Product Requirements Document
└── project-memory.json # Project-scoped knowledge store
OMG includes pre/post tool-use hooks (.github/hooks/) that act as safety nets:
Pre-tool-use guards:
- Blocks modifications to
node_modules/ - Prevents direct
.envfile edits - Stops deletion of critical config files (
package.json,tsconfig.json,.gitignore) - Prevents
git push --forceand destructive git operations
Post-tool-use tracking:
- Logs tool usage for debugging (
OMG_DEBUG=1) - Tracks file modifications for omg-autopilot phase awareness
- Monitors test results for ultraqa detection

OMG uses structured git trailers to preserve decision context:
fix(auth): prevent silent session drops during long-running ops
Auth service returns inconsistent status codes on token expiry,
so the interceptor catches all 4xx and triggers inline refresh.
Constraint: Auth service does not support token introspection
Rejected: Extend token TTL to 24h | security policy violation
Confidence: high
Scope-risk: narrow
Available trailers: Constraint, Rejected, Directive, Confidence, Scope-risk, Not-tested

Made Opus 4.7 routing tier-safe by adding Claude Opus 4.6 (copilot) as an inline fallback.
- The 7 deep-reasoning agents (
analyst,architect,code-reviewer,critic,omg-coordinator,planner,security-reviewer) now use a YAML model array:["Claude Opus 4.7 (copilot)", "Claude Opus 4.6 (copilot)"]. - Why: VS Code Copilot blocks subagent calls that exceed the active chat model's cost-tier ceiling. With a 7.5x base model (e.g.
GPT-5.5), anOpus 4.7-only request was hard-failing instead of degrading. - New behavior: when the session ceiling allows it, Opus 4.7 is used. Otherwise the agent transparently falls back to Opus 4.6 instead of failing.
- No change to GPT-5.5 (15 agents) or Sonnet 4.6 (6 agents) routing.

Bug Fix: Skill name collision with VS Code built-in Autopilot
- Renamed
/autopilotskill to/omg-autopilotto avoid collision with VS Code's built-in "Autopilot (Preview)" permission level - Fixed invalid YAML frontmatter in all SKILL.md files: removed unsupported
allowed-toolsfield, renamedhinttoargument-hintper VS Code spec - Root cause: The skill name
autopilottriggered VS Code's internal permission mode switch instead of loading the OMG skill instructions - Scope: Updated skill directories, MCP server code, agent definitions, cross-references, tests, and all documentation
